Abstract
The invention discloses a kind of solar energy sea water desalination apparatus of changeable flow, its structure includes desalination apparatus, controller, solar panel, pipeline, neutralize device, more medium filter, water pump, pedestal, solar panel is installed at the top of desalination apparatus, it is inlaid with controller on the outside of desalination apparatus, desalination apparatus side bottom is welded with pedestal, more medium filter is installed on pedestal, water pump, water pump is connected by pipeline with more medium filter, more medium filter is connected with desalination apparatus, desalination apparatus is connected to device is neutralized by water pipe, device is neutralized by shell, hopper, pause switch mechanism, accelerator, conveying device, scraper, unidirectional transmission, mobile device, intermittent transmission device, water wheel arrangement, water pipe forms, the beneficial effects of the invention are as follows:The seawater after desalination is neutralized by neutralizing device, prevents water system to be etched, ensures the normal operation of water system and the safe drinking water of the people.

Background technology
Sea water desalination can increase local gross amount of water resources as a kind of open source technology, since sea water desalination is with the energy
Water source is changed, therefore energy consumption is still larger.For the island of not power grid, solved using traditional fossil fuel (coal, oil)
Sea water desalination energy problem easily leads to the destruction of island Vulnerable Ecosystem, and transport and maintenance cost are excessively high, and China
Fossil energy especially coal and oil relative deficiency, reserves are limited, and more use is fewer, are faced with exhausted danger, Er Qieshi
It is very unfortunate for working as fuel that oil and coal are important chemical raw material, and the oxidation of a large amount of CO2 and sulphur will be discharged in burning fuel
Object leads to greenhouse effects and acid rain, deteriorates earth environment.If solving these areas without electricity from the existing power transmission network construction of line
Powerup issue, investment cost is big, builds the transmission line of electricity of 1km, is equivalent to the investment cost of 5~6kW solar-electricity equipment, for
Remote small island will build a submarine cable expense higher.
Seawater, which is talked, at present removes in seawater existing alkalescent substance in a salt form so that desalination water is in acidity, such as
Fruit is directly entered water system, can corrode water system, accelerates water system aging, in addition, the water capacity of highly acid easily leads to confession
Heavy metal in water metal device leaches, and into water supply, threatens the health of the common people.
